- Notes
-
1 IC. Vollstereo, NF-Verstärker mit zwei Endstufen je 40 W (Sinus), bei KW1 = 8 Kreise. Gehäuse und Front mattschwarz UKW-Stationstasten: 5+1.
Ultraschall-Fernbedienung für den UKW-Sendersuchlauf.
